Juniper Networks' case study highlights their collaboration with the Massachusetts Broadband Institute (MBI) to address a significant 'digital divide' in rural Western Massachusetts. The region suffered from limited or slow broadband access in public buildings and homes, impeding educational and economic progress. With approximately $90 million in funding, MBI implemented MassBroadband 123, a comprehensive fiber network solution. Juniper's technical capabilities were crucial in establishing this complex infrastructure, which connected over 250 schools and various public institutions.
